Immunohistochemistry (Frozen sections) - Anti-Dnmt3b antibody (AB122932)
Expression of Dnmt3b in mouse embyos was examined by immuno-fluorescence staining using 1/1000 ab122932.
Mouse embryos at E4.5, 5.5 and 7.0 were fixed in cold acetone and stained with ab122932 or DAPI (blue). The antibody was detected with anti-rabbit IgG conjugated with ALEXA568 (red). The ICM (the inner cell mass) and trophectoderm (T) are indicated by arrows and arrowheads, respectively. The epiblast (E), and the embryonic ectoderm (EE) and extraembryonic region (EX) are indicated by square brackets. Dnmt3b existed at E4.5-7.0, in ICM at E4.5, the epiblast at E5.5, and the embryonic ectoderm at E7.0.

Immunocytochemistry/ Immunofluorescence - Anti-Dnmt3b antibody (AB122932)
Immunocytochemistry/ Immunofluorescence analysis of wild-type (left) and Dnmt3b/3a knockout (right) mouse embryonic stem cells using ab122932 at 1/5000 dilution. DNA was stained with DAPI (bottom). Cell were fixed with 4% PFA/PBS for 30 min at 4℃.
